Setting a large image size slows down performance and consumes RAM #447

Open or create an image by setting a large size. Example: 6000 x 6000 pixels. Select the brush and use it on the image. Lines are drawn abruptly with a time delay. When you open the Task Manager, you can see that the consumption of RAM is very large.

Steps to reproduce the behavior:

  1. Open / create large image
  2. Using the tool

Expected Behavior: tools run smoothly, just like editing smaller images.
2

OS: Windows 10
Version: 1.6.7
